Maximizing x86 Performance: Optimization Strategies
To achieve blazing-fast speeds on current x86 architectures, developers must utilize a range of sophisticated optimization techniques. Firstly ensure your code is structured for the target processing unit.
Carefully select data structures that reduce cache access requests. Harness instruction-level parallelism by combining operations that are simultaneous. Furthermore, profile your code to identify bottlenecks and tailor optimizations accordingly.
- Utilize loop unrolling and instruction scheduling for enhanced instruction density.
- Optimize memory access patterns to decrease data transfer overhead.
- Employ compiler flags that enable detailed optimization options.
Inspecting x86 Applications: Tips and Tricks
Developing software for the x86 architecture can be a rewarding experience, but debugging these applications can sometimes feel like navigating a labyrinth. Fortunately, several strategies can help you efficiently pinpoint and resolve issues in your x86 code. A crucial initial step is to understand yourself with the structure of the x86 processor. Understanding how registers, memory addresses, and instruction sets work will provide a solid foundation for analyzing problems.
Leveraging a debugger is another critical tool in your toolkit. Debuggers allow you to execute code line by line, inspect variable values, and observe program flow. Familiarize yourself with the functions of your chosen debugger and harness them to their fullest potential.
- Think about using a breakpoint, which is a point in your code where execution pauses, allowing you to inspect the program's state at that moment.
- Implement logging statements throughout your code to output relevant information during runtime. This can help you track down errors and grasp the flow of execution.
Remember that debugging is an iterative process that often involves attempt and error. Be patient, persistent, and don't be afraid to consult help from online resources or experienced developers.
